Home Care Job Responsibilities

Typical duties of a home care worker in Ireland include:

  • Assisting with personal hygiene and grooming
  • Helping clients with mobility and daily activities
  • Preparing meals and assisting with feeding
  • Administering medication (if trained)
  • Providing companionship and emotional support
  • Light housekeeping and errands
  • Monitoring health conditions and reporting changes

Salary of Home Care Jobs in Ireland 2025

One of the main reasons for the popularity of home care jobs in Ireland with visa sponsorship is the attractive pay.

Average Salary:

  • Hourly wage: €12 – €18 per hour
  • Monthly salary: €2,000 – €3,000
  • Annual salary: €26,000 – €36,000

Additional benefits may include:

  • Paid overtime
  • Night shift allowances
  • Paid annual leave
  • Pension contributions
  • Free or subsidized training

Live-in caregivers may also receive free accommodation and meals, reducing living expenses significantly.


Eligibility Criteria for Visa Sponsorship

To qualify for home care assistant jobs in Ireland with visa sponsorship, applicants typically need:

  • Minimum age: 18 years
  • Basic English communication skills
  • High school certificate or equivalent
  • Caregiving experience (preferred but not always required)
  • Police clearance certificate
  • Medical fitness certificate

Formal qualifications such as QQI Level 5 Healthcare Support are an advantage, but many employers sponsor training after hiring.


Ireland Work Visa for Home Care Workers 2025

Most foreign applicants are sponsored under the General Employment Permit.

Key Visa Details:

  • Valid for up to 2 years (renewable)
  • Employer-sponsored
  • Allows family reunification after a certain period
  • Eligible for Stamp 4 (permanent residency) after 5 years

Since home care is considered a shortage occupation, approval chances are high when applying through a licensed employer.


How to Apply for Home Care Jobs in Ireland with Visa Sponsorship

Follow these steps to secure a job legally:

Step 1: Prepare Documents

  • Updated CV (European format preferred)
  • Cover letter highlighting caregiving interest
  • Passport copy
  • Experience certificates (if any)

Step 2: Apply Online

Search for employers offering visa sponsorship through:

  • Licensed home care agencies
  • Irish healthcare recruitment companies
  • Government-approved job portals

Step 3: Interview & Job Offer

Most interviews are conducted online. Once selected, you will receive a job offer and employment contract.

Step 4: Work Permit Application

Your employer applies for your work permit through Ireland’s Department of Enterprise.

Step 5: Visa & Travel

After permit approval, apply for an Irish work visa and travel to Ireland.
